WebJan 1, 2010 · Rheometer: An instrument measuring rheological properties. Rheopectic: Time-dependent shear thickening. Shear (strain) rate: Change in strain with respect to time. Simple shear: The relative motion of a surface with respect to another parallel surface creating a shear field within the fluid contained between the surfaces.
